A Graduate Certificate in Travel Photography Architecture offers specialized training for aspiring professionals seeking to combine their passion for travel with architectural photography. The program focuses on developing technical skills and artistic vision, equipping graduates with a unique skillset highly sought after in the travel and architectural photography industries.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ering advanced photographic techniques for capturing architectural details in diverse travel settings. Students gain proficiency in post-processing, composition, and storytelling through imagery, creating compelling narratives that showcase both architectural beauty and the essence of a location. This includes learning about lighting, perspective, and utilizing various photographic equipment effectively.
The duration of such a certificate program varies but often ranges from a few months to a year, depending on the intensity and course load. Many programs offer flexible scheduling to accommodate working professionals. A strong portfolio developed during the program becomes a key asset for securing internships or employment.
